England labour to opening win over Haiti thanks to Georgia Stanway penalty
SECOND TIME: Georgia Stanway gets England's only score of the game from the penalty spot on her taking attempt, Kerly Theus saved the initial penalty but VAR intercepted for a retake as Theus left the line too early. Pic: Justin Setterfield/Getty Images
Georgia Stanway's retaken first-half penalty was enough to earn England a nervy 1-0 victory over World Cup debutants Haiti in their Group D opener at Brisbane Stadium.
This was not the decisive victory most had predicted for the European champions and world's number-four side against a team 49 places below them in the FIFA rankings.
